Spreading your loot around in the Rust game is an age old tried and true method of making sure you keep some materials around even if you do get raided. This method combines this theory along with the power of new tech to have easy access to all the loot (but the raiders still don't).
This system also incorporates nearly every other item system you might need (auto-smelting, auto-crafting) right alongside the main system the keeps your loot spread.
Using concepts such as dedicated drop points, locked down and mitigated loss access points, furnace integration, autocrafter integration, and item pushing subsystems to drop points makes it so that once this is all set up you will spend minimal amount of time managing your base throughout a wipe.
I did forget to mention the auto upkeep systems, but I think if you can figure all this out, you can figure those out as well (essentially another loot sampler that pushes to the tool cupboard).
